Lorene Mackey Rice, Age 99, of Maysville, Kentucky passed away peacefully at her home Tuesday February 6, 2018.
Lorene was born in Jack town, Kentucky April 26, 1918 to the late Thomas and Hazel McCann Mackey. Lorene was a Homemaker,She was class Valedictorian of her graduating class from Vanceburg High School. She was a student her entire life reading everything and anything she could. Lorene was a member of the Eastern Star where she served as worthy grand matron numerous times through the years. Lorene lived on a farm most of her life with her husband in Tollesboro, Kentucky until 2006 when they moved to Maysville, Kentucky. She had a tremendous command of the political world and could Identify anyone in the political scene. She was a member of the United Methodist Church in Tollesboro, Kentucky.
